Interior Department Rule Aims to Crack Down on Methane Leaks From Oil, Gas Drilling on Public Lands

Interior Department Rule Aims to Crack Down on Methane Leaks From Oil, Gas Drilling on Public Lands

WASHINGTON (AP) — The Biden administration issued a final rule Wednesday aimed at curbing methane leaks from oil and gas drilling on federal and tribal lands, its latest action to crack down on emissions of methane, a potent greenhouse gas that contributes significantly to global warming. Man to Plead Guilty in ‘Killing Spree’ of Eagles and Other Birds for Feathers Prized by Tribes

Man to Plead Guilty in ‘Killing Spree’ of Eagles and Other Birds for Feathers Prized by Tribes

A Washington state man accused of helping kill more than 3,000 birds — including eagles on a Montana Indian reservation — then illegally selling their carcasses and feathers intends to plead guilty to illegal wildlife trafficking and other criminal charges, court documents show. Western Monarch Butterflies Overwintering in California Dropped by 30% Last Year, Researchers Say

Western Monarch Butterflies Overwintering in California Dropped by 30% Last Year, Researchers Say

SAN FRANCISCO (AP) — The number of western monarch butterflies overwintering in California dropped by 30% last year, likely due to how wet it was, researchers said Tuesday. Report: Another Jaguar Sighting in Southern Arizona, 8th Different One in Southwestern US Since 1996

Report: Another Jaguar Sighting in Southern Arizona, 8th Different One in Southwestern US Since 1996

PHOENIX (AP) — There’s been another jaguar sighting in southern Arizona and it’s the eighth different jaguar documented in the southwestern U.S. since 1996, according to wildlife officials.
